The red wine Brunello di Montalcino DOCG, vintage 2014 from the winery Caprili has been rated in 2019 by Othmar Kiem, Simon Staffler with 92 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Sangiovese from the region Tuscany in Italy.

Tasting Notes

92
Tasting from 14.03.2019: Othmar Kiem, Simon Staffler

Dark ruby red colour. Very rich nose of ripe plums and Amarena cherries, pepper, cardamom and black olives. Clear and juicy palate, opens wide with elegant fruit, long structure, velvety texture paired with slightly scratchy tannins, long finish.
